Bredbury to Bingley by train

A train trip from Bredbury to Bingley takes about 2hrs 34 mins on average, covering roughly 31 miles (50 kilometres). With around 38 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£35.80,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Bredbury to Bingley start from £35.80 one way, or £35.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Bredbury to Bingley are available for £36.90 one way, or £49.80 return

Facilities at Bredbury Station

Bredbury Station combines simplicity with essential amenities. Open for ticket purchasing from 06:20 to 20:40 on weekdays and with slightly reduced hours on Saturdays, it is convenient for early-bird commuters and evening travelers alike. While there's no service on Sundays, ticket machines are available for easy access to ticket collection or purchasing, but unfortunately, you won't find accessible ticket machines here.

For those requiring auditory assistance, an induction loop is available. However, for those who might seek mobility support, access is thoroughly described but not entirely step-free, classified as a Category C station. Notably, while facilities for storing bicycles do exist, there's no availability for bicycle hire directly from the station premises.

Facilities and Amenities at Bingley Station

Bingley Station is well-equipped to cater to your travel needs. The station operates a ticket office with opening hours from 06:10 to 19:00 on weekdays and 08:40 to 16:00 on Sundays. It's reassuring to know that ticket machines, including accessible ones, are available to assist you with your purchases and collections. For those who prefer digital solutions, smartcard issuance and validation are also supported here.

If you need help, the station staff are ready to assist during ticket office hours. While there aren't dedicated customer help points, an assistance helpline (08002006060) is available. CCTV surveillance enhances security, ensuring a safe environment for all travelers. Accessibility remains a priority, with step-free access available in parts of the station, cementing Bingley’s reputation as a scooter-friendly location!
